Radio Cayman’s interview on Alzheimer’s Training

This is the Radio Cayman’s news excerpt with Chairperson Dorothy Davis informing the public about the upcoming Alzheimer’s Disease and Care Training to be held on Monday 26th August, Wednesday 28th August and Thursday 29th August 2013.

The training is being delivered by Dr. Rosemary Laird, Geriatric Internist and Lecturer at Florida State University and Mr. James Smith, Clinical Director of the Alzheimer’s Project in Tallahassee Florida on behalf of the Florida Association for Volunteer Action in the Caribbean and the Americas (FAVACA) in association with ADACI.

The training, which will be held in the Hibiscus Conference Room at the George Town Hospital, is free of cost and is open to the Medical professionals, Police, Firemen and Paramedics, Caregivers and other community members.
